Pastor’s Pen for Sunday, 6-21-26
In the message today I’m continuing with pt. 2 of a message that we shared on Mother’s Day titled “It Starts at Home.” In that message I looked at scriptures throughout the Bible on the family. First and foremost, the institution of the family was God’s idea. “You were united to your wife by the Lord. In God’s wise plan, when you married, the two of you became one person in his sight. And what does he want? Godly children from your union. Therefore, guard your passions! Keep faith with the wife of your youth. For the Lord, the God of Israel, says he hates divorce and cruel men. Therefore, control your passions – let there be no divorcing of your wives,” Malachi 2:15, 16 (The Living Bible). It all starts at home. We first are introduced to God at home, at least I think most of us are, and I know some people find God outside of their homes, if theirs is not a Christian household. God certainly wants godly seed from the marriage relationship, training the children from that union in the knowledge of the Lord. Deuteronomy 6:1–7 (KJV): Now these are the commandments, the statutes, and the judgments, which the Lord your God commanded to teach you, that ye might do them in the land whither ye go to possess it: 2 That thou mightest fear the Lord thy God, to keep all his statutes and his commandments, which I command thee, thou, and thy son, and thy son’s son, all the days of thy life; and that thy days may be prolonged. 3 Hear therefore, O Israel, and observe to do it; that it may be well with thee, and that ye may increase mightily, as the Lord God of thy fathers hath promised thee, in the land that floweth with milk and honey. 4 Hear, O Israel: The Lord our God is one Lord: 5 And thou shalt love the Lord thy God with all thine heart, and with all thy soul, and with all thy might. 6 And these words, which I command thee this day, shall be in thine heart: 7 And thou shalt teach them diligently unto thy children, and shalt talk of them when thou sittest in thine house, and when thou walkest by the way, and when thou liest down, and when thou risest up. The institution of the family was ordained by God whereby the message of the kingdom would be taught from generation to generation.
